Analysis
Italy recorded 12.6% for pension fund assets to gdp in 2020. That is the highest value across all 20 years on record.
The figure is up 16.6% on the previous year and up 139.7% over ten years.
Over the whole period, pension fund assets to gdp in Italy peaked at 12.6% in 2020 and was at its lowest, 2.1%, in 2001.
That places Italy 47th out of 87 countries with data for 2020, putting it in the middle of the range.
The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.
Pension fund assets to GDP in Italy, year by year
| Year | % | Change |
|---|---|---|
| 2001 | 2.1% | — |
| 2002 | 2.2% | +3.2% |
| 2003 | 2.3% | +5.2% |
| 2004 | 2.4% | +4.8% |
| 2005 | 2.7% | +9.0% |
| 2006 | 3.4% | +27.4% |
| 2007 | 3.7% | +8.3% |
| 2008 | 3.9% | +5.4% |
| 2009 | 4.7% | +22.2% |
| 2010 | 5.3% | +11.2% |
| 2011 | 5.6% | +6.6% |
| 2012 | 6.6% | +17.1% |
| 2013 | 7.3% | +11.6% |
| 2014 | 8.2% | +12.2% |
| 2015 | 8.6% | +4.3% |
| 2016 | 9.2% | +7.5% |
| 2017 | 9.6% | +4.3% |
| 2018 | 9.8% | +1.1% |
| 2019 | 10.8% | +11.1% |
| 2020 | 12.6% | +16.6% |

About this data
Ratio of assets of pension funds to GDP. A pension fund is any plan, fund, or scheme that provides retirement income. Data taken from a variety of sources such as OECD, AIOS, FIAP and national sources.
